Polyphony has released the 2.03 update for Gran Turismo 5 ahead of new DLC packs available today. The 225mb 2.03 update includes the following:
- 12 new My Home theme colors and 12 new wallpapers for [GT Mode] have been added to the game. Please find these from the [My Home Settings]-[My Home Design] menu on the left side of the screen.
- Tire wear speed prediction has been added to the pit stop decisions in B-Spec, to prevent tires from wearing out completely during long races.
- Regenerative braking (which recovers energy by converting kinetic energy into electricity) in electric cars have been made stronger to extend driving distance.
- Electric cars will now also creep forward (as in standard automatic cars) when the brake is released without pressing the accelerator.
- Regarding the Chaparral 2J race car’s performance points, the increased performance factor due to the downforce produced by the fan is now calculated.
[Correction of Known Issues]
- A issue has been corrected where the car would pit in unintentionally during the last lap of a B spec race.
The Car Pack 3 and Speed Test Course Pack DLC include:
- Nissan Leaf G ’11
- Mini Cooper S Countryman ’11
- Jaguar XJR-9 LM Race Car ’88
- Lamborghini Aventador LP
- Volkswagen 1200 ’66
- Aston Martin V12 Vantage ’10
New Seasonal Events at Rome City, Tokyo Route 246 and Madrid City have also become available.
